Glentoran striker Jordan Jenkins says he is determined to keep raising his game as the Glens prepare for Friday night’s Sports Direct Premiership clash away to unbeaten Coleraine at The Showgrounds (kick-off 7.45pm).

The 25-year-old East Belfast forward has begun the season in fine form, contributing four goals in all competitions and supplying the assist for Danny Amos’ opening-day winner at Portadown.

Jenkins struck in successive league victories over Glenavon and Crusaders before adding the second in a 2–0 win at Ballymena United, while also finding the net in the County Antrim Shield win against Ards, a run that has helped Glentoran make an unbeaten start to the season.

He has carried that momentum from last season’s campaign, when he finished as the club’s top scorer with 18 goals and recently committed his future to the club with a new two-year contract.

Jenkins’ goals and all-round play reflect the confidence of a striker carrying momentum from a breakthrough year into the new campaign, while clearly enjoying his football at the BetMcLean Oval.

Friday’s opponents Coleraine have also made an eye-catching start to the Sports Direct Premiership, winning five of their opening six fixtures to sit second in the table.

Ruaidhrí Higgins’ side opened with a victory over Larne, followed by home success against Dungannon Swifts, a win at Glenavon and commanding victories away to Crusaders and Portadown. Their only dropped points so far came in a draw with Cliftonville.
